Binoy Mathew

Binoy Mathew
Senior Programme Officer – Communications
Voluntary Health Association of India

As Public Health & Communication Professional  with over ten years’ experience, Binoy has strong skills in developing and implementing strategic communication programs, media management, advocacy, public relations, media liaisoning, and communications with substantive experience in media relations and organizing events. Binoy holds a Master’s Degree in Mass Communication and certificate course on communications from Johns Hopkins Bloomberg School of Public Health, United States of America (USA). He also holds a certificate from BBC for training and capacity building in the area of media advocacy in order to build capacities in handling media advocacy issues.

Binoy develops and implements communication strategy at the national and state level and provides technical guidance to the state partners in terms of the distribution of resources, knowledge sharing and constant exchange of information with media and key stakeholders. He also provides support to other public health organizations working on tobacco control in India. During his tenure, he has produced numerous press releases, background documents, opinion editorials, briefing notes and other materials on issues dealing with public health concerns. He also possesses additional skills in implementing social media campaigns with the direct purpose of promoting policy change.

He represented VHAI at many international platforms and has presented papers at various international conferences. He was part of Media Committee Group set up by Ministry of Health & Family Welfare, Government of India for organizing & coordinating media and communication activities during the Conference of Party (COP) Conference held in India from 7th to 16th Nov, 2016. He is also Member of National Tobacco Control Programme committee of Ministry of health and Family welfare

Mr. Mathew has been recognized for his diligent efforts in media briefs prepared for tobacco control campaigns and received a letter of appreciation from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, Government of India.

He also received Meritorious Service Award from VHAI in 2012 and long service award in 2015 for his outstanding contribution to VHAI.
